rev limiter

last nigt I had my first race aganist a 240sx on a road that was damp due to a afternoon shower. anyway, i had a good take off but, in 2 i got major tire spin and i redlined for about 5 or 6 sec. So, i was wondering if this will damage the motor. I own a 2005 srt-4 with no mods. Any replys would help fellow srt owners. I won by the way by 3 or 4 cars.

nope all is well, the limiter is there for a reason. just don't hold it that high all the time.

while racing i tend to smack my limiter 3-4 times before i realized it needs shifted. but obviously don't be dumb and go out and old it there for any period of time over like 5sec. like you might do in a burn out at the strip scenario.
